在前端技术日新月异的今天,掌握前沿的技能和思维方式变得至关重要。本讲座旨在帮助您深入理解前端技术的核心,打破传统认知的局限,探索全新的技术视野。以下是讲座的详细内容:

一、讲座背景

1.1 前端技术发展趋势

随着互联网的快速发展,前端技术经历了从静态网页到动态交互、再到移动端适配的演变。如今,前端技术正朝着模块化、组件化、工程化方向发展。

1.2 技术与思维方式的融合

在掌握前端技术的同时,培养良好的思维方式同样重要。本讲座将探讨如何将技术思维与设计思维、系统思维相结合,提升整体的技术素养。

二、讲座内容

2.1 前端技术概述

2.1.1 HTML5/CSS3

介绍HTML5和CSS3的基本概念、新特性和常用技术,如Flexbox、Grid等。

2.1.2 JavaScript

探讨JavaScript的发展历程、核心语法、ES6/ES7/ES8等新特性,以及主流的JavaScript框架(如React、Vue、Angular)。

2.1.3 前端构建工具

介绍Webpack、Gulp、Rollup等前端构建工具,以及它们在项目开发中的应用。

2.2 设计思维与前端技术

2.2.1 设计思维概述

介绍设计思维的概念、原则和步骤,以及如何在前端开发中应用设计思维。

2.2.2 前端用户体验(UX)

探讨前端用户体验的概念、设计原则和常用工具,如原型设计、交互设计等。

2.3 系统思维与前端技术

2.3.1 系统思维概述

介绍系统思维的概念、原则和方法,以及如何在前端开发中应用系统思维。

2.3.2 前端架构设计

探讨前端架构设计的原则、方法和常用模式,如MVC、MVVM、React Hooks等。

三、案例分析

3.1 案例一:React组件化开发

以React框架为例,详细讲解组件化开发的原理、实践和技巧。

3.2 案例二:前端性能优化

分析前端性能优化的关键点,如代码分割、懒加载、缓存策略等。

四、互动环节

在讲座过程中,将设置互动环节,邀请听众提问和分享自己的实践经验。

五、讲座总结

通过本次讲座,您将能够:

  • 理解前端技术的发展趋势和核心概念。
  • 掌握设计思维和系统思维在前端开发中的应用。
  • 提升前端架构设计和性能优化的能力。

期待与您共同开启这场颠覆认知的前端技术思维之旅!